A Pugh and Tress Mystery Twosome
Adaptations of stories by Richard Marsh, Circa 1898.
Audiobook adaptation and narration by Mark Bielecki
The first story is The Puzzle. Pugh and Tress are rival collectors who are sometimes the best of friends and sometimes the worst of enemies. The story is about a wooden box that seems impossible to open. The second story, The Pipe involves a strange looking pipe with peculiar powers. Pugh and Tress prove that mysteries don’t always involve crimes.
Both stories were adapted to modern English while keeping the original storylines intact.
